关于iOS下的渲染基础
2020-07-05 本文已影响0人
iOS_Ken
前言
-
渲染是一个复杂的过程,离不开硬件和软件的分开配合的过程。今天和大家一起了解一下
GPU
和CPU
的基本工作原理以及分析页面卡顿
的原因。 -
1.GPU和CPU基本概念
-
GPU
GPU 图形处理器(英语:Graphics Processing Unit,缩写:GPU),视觉处理器。对CPU提交的数据进行处理后显示。 -
CPU
CPU中央处理器(CPU,central processing unit)作为计算机系统的运算和控制核心。 -
2.计算机的渲染原理
-
CPU内部组成图
图片1.png -
GPU内部组成图
图片2.png -
随机扫描显示
CRT显示器概述图
a71ea8d3fd1f41343fe13bd0241f95cad0c85e4d.jpeg -
概念
电子束随着线条的显示位置而移动,按亮度要求轰击荧光而发光。
图片3.png -
随机扫描显示
image.png -
光栅扫描显示系统组成
image.png -
光栅扫描显示系统组成
image.png -
屏幕扫描
image.png